WHAT DOES ONE'S "CALLING MEAN"?

There is a general misunderstand of what our "vocation" or "calling" is in life. In the old days, pre- Reformation, a vocation was only a religious calling where someone would take a vow of some sort, go join and monastery and live a secluded life until his/her days were up.

The Reformation changed all of that and Martin Luther among others expounded on what the Christian life is and the many attributes of one's calling in life.
